Innovative Box Packaging For Food: The Future Of Sustainable And Convenient Food Packaging

In recent years, the way we package and consume food has undergone a significant transformation. With increasing awareness about the harmful effects of plastic waste on the environment, there has been a growing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ly packaging solutions. This has led to a rise in the popularity of box packaging for food, which offers a range of benefits over traditional plastic packaging.

box packaging for food is not a new concept, but with advancements in technology and design, it has become more innovative and versatile than ever before. From small takeaway boxes to larger meal kits, this type of packaging is being used by restaurants, food manufacturers, and retailers to provide customers with convenient and sustainable options for storing and transporting food.

One of the key benefits of box packaging for food is its sustainability. Unlike plastic packaging, which can take hundreds of years to decompose, cardboard boxes are made from renewable materials and are easily recyclable. This makes them a much more environmentally friendly option for packaging food products. In addition, many box packaging solutions are now being made from recycled materials, further reducing their environmental impact.

Another advantage of box packaging for food is its versatility. Cardboard boxes can be easily customized to suit different types of food products, from sandwiches and salads to full meals. They can also be printed with branding and logos, making them an effective marketing tool for food businesses. In addition, box packaging can be designed to be stackable and easily transportable, making it ideal for takeout and delivery services.

box packaging for food also offers practical benefits for both consumers and businesses. For consumers, box packaging provides a convenient way to store and transport food, whether it’s a quick snack or a full meal. Boxes can be designed with compartments to keep different foods separate, preventing them from getting soggy or mixing together. This makes them ideal for on-the-go meals or picnics.

For businesses, box packaging offers a cost-effective and efficient way to package and distribute food products. Unlike plastic packaging, which can be expensive to produce and transport, cardboard boxes are lightweight and easy to assemble. They can also be easily stacked and stored, saving valuable space in kitchens and warehouses. This makes them a practical choice for restaurants, caterers, and food manufacturers looking to streamline their operations.

In addition to their practical benefits, box packaging for food also offers a more hygienic option for storing and transporting food. Cardboard boxes can be lined with food-safe materials to keep food fresh and prevent contamination. This is especially important for perishable items like meats and dairy products, which require proper storage to maintain their quality and safety.
